Compatibility with My Motherboard

One of the first things I checked was the compatibility of the WiFi card with my motherboard. Here are the key points I considered:

  • PCIe Slots: Most WiFi cards connect via a PCIe slot. I ensured that my motherboard had an available slot for installation.
  • M.2 Slots: If I had a newer motherboard, I could also consider M.2 WiFi cards, which are compact and often easier to install.
  • Drivers and Support: I looked for cards that offered good driver support for my operating system. This was crucial for a smooth setup and optimal performance.

Key Features to Look For

As I researched various WiFi cards, there were several features that stood out and influenced my decision:

  • Speed Ratings: I focused on cards that supported the latest WiFi standards, such as WiFi 6 (802.11ax), which promised faster speeds and improved performance.
  • Antenna Design: I paid attention to the antenna configuration. Cards with multiple antennas often provided better range and signal strength.
  • Bluetooth Capability: Some WiFi cards also came with Bluetooth functionality, which was a bonus for me, as I wanted to connect various devices without needing extra dongles.

Installation Process

Once I narrowed down my options and made a purchase, I prepared for installation. Here’s a brief overview of what I did:

  • Gathering Tools: I made sure I had the necessary tools, like a screwdriver and anti-static wrist strap, to prevent any damage during installation.
  • Following Instructions: I carefully followed the installation instructions included with the card, ensuring I connected it properly to the motherboard.
  • Driver Installation: After physically installing the card, I downloaded and installed the latest drivers from the manufacturer’s website for optimal performance.
